The Iron Rep is a man called to help other men know God and know their purpose through Men of Iron's programs and resources. Part disciple-maker, part entrepreneur, he knows how to cast vision, build partnerships, and fund the mission. The Iron Rep builds relationships with local churches, businesses, and community leaders to spark Christ-centered change and impact his community--one man at a time.

Responsibilities
Equip and disciple men
through Men of Iron's programs and resources, including Strong27 mentorships, small groups, retreats, and events.
Recruit new and strengthen existing partnerships
with churches, businesses, and community leaders to expand Men of Iron's reach.

Develop regional funding and sustainability
, cultivating donor relationships and hosting local events that support Men of Iron's mission.
Collaborate with the national Men of Iron team
, sharing stories, results, and best practices to grow impact across all regions.
This position is both
entrepreneurial and pastoral
-ideal for a self-motivated leader passionate about discipleship, community engagement, and helping men become the leaders God designed them to be.
